Prava Pay

Give your AI Agent a one-time card to make payments-safely

0 upvotes💰 Finance & PaymentsMay 2026

Prava Pay is an innovative fintech tool designed to enhance the security of AI-driven transactions. By providing AI agents with one-time virtual cards, it allows these agents to make payments for activities like ordering lunch, coffee, groceries, or booking reservations without exposing sensitive real card data. This solution is particularly valuable for businesses integrating AI agents such as OpenClaw, Hermes, Claude Code, and Codex, offering an extra layer of security and privacy. Prava Pay’s partnership with Visa Intelligent Commerce signals its reliability and industry backing, with plans to expand to other card networks. Its seamless integration into AI workflows makes it a compelling choice for organizations looking to automate payments safely while maintaining compliance and reducing fraud risk.

Subscription Day for iOS

Track paid subscriptions w/ analytics from multiple sources

311 upvotes💰 Finance & PaymentsFeb 2026

Subscription Day for iOS is a robust subscription management and analytics tool designed for individuals who need to keep track of multiple paid subscriptions across various sources. With its recent redesign, it offers a seamless experience on both Mac and iOS devices, allowing users to monitor, organize, and analyze their subscription spending effortlessly. Its integration of detailed analytics helps users identify patterns, manage renewals, and avoid unnecessary charges, making it ideal for personal finance enthusiasts and busy professionals alike. What sets Subscription Day apart is its ability to consolidate subscription data from various platforms into a single, easy-to-navigate interface, empowering users to make informed financial decisions. Its clean design and intuitive features make it accessible for users of all levels seeking better control over their recurring expenses.
